Your next step would be to appeal. Usually unless you report the unusual activity prior to them sending you a notice it's pretty unlikely they'll unban it.

That doesn't mean you can't have another adsense though. You can form an LLC and place the adsense under the LLC rather than your name. Unfortunately once you're banned you can never create another adsense under your own name. LLC's are a good way to get around that though.

Should I quit my job to begin freelance work in the industry? by chaser09 in Filmmakers

[–]ProjectZain 1 point2 points  (0 children)

It may be a good idea to start out doing freelance part-time. Do it on weekends for small businesses in your area. You'll get a taste of what it's like working for clients and you'll get an idea of whether it's something you really want to do full-time. You'll also build up a small reel of commercial work (or whatever you want to shoot for clients).

One of the biggest ways to get work is word of mouth. Help out small businesses in your area, maybe give them a deal or do a job Pro-Bono and they'll spread it around that you're a good person to work with. Getting jobs is much easier when you have a good reputation.

You'll also want to start a website where you can show off your reel and resume. Search Engine Optimization is key here as it will lead local businesses to you first when they want to find someone to shoot for them.

Apart from that there's not much I can say. But be ready to be faced with clients that don't want to pay or simply don't understand the value of what video can do for their business. That's your job. You need to show them why they need video and if you can make them understand the value of what you do, you'll do just fine.
